Description

The Brazalo 501 Blade Tandem Spinnerbait represents the next evolution in Brazalo’s spinnerbait lineup. Built with a compact profile , this bait is designed to get more bites, especially in pressured water, while slipping cleanly through cover where bulkier spinnerbaits struggle. Featuring a tandem Indiana and Oklahoma blade configuration , the 501 Blade delivers a unique combination of flash and vibration. The Indiana blade provides strong thump and lift, while the Oklahoma blade adds extra shimmer and shake, creating a balanced presentation that triggers reaction strikes in both clear and stained water. Whether you’re slow-rolling through cover, fishing shallow grass, or targeting bass around wood and laydowns, the Brazalo 501 Blade Tandem Spinnerbait offers consistent vibration, improved hookup potential, and the compact efficiency serious anglers demand.

Field Notes

Use this compact tandem spinnerbait around shallow cover, grass, wood, and laydowns where a smaller profile can get more bites. The Indiana/Oklahoma blade mix gives a balance of thump and flash, making it a good choice for slow-rolling or steady retrieves in clear to stained water.

Pros

  • Compact profile for pressured fish
  • Tandem blades add both flash and vibration
  • Tracks well through cover

Cons

  • Not ideal for very heavy vegetation
  • Blade combo may be less subtle than single-blade options in ultra-clear water
